Shams Al-Baroudi Reveals Heartwarming Moments with Late Husband Hassan Youssef
Retired actress Shams Al-Baroudi shared touching moments with her late husband Hassan Youssef, highlighting how his trust and support played a pivotal role in her decision to retire from acting
Moments of Love and Trust 💌
Shams Al-Baroudi shared on Facebook the profound bond she had with her late husband, emphasizing that love and trust were the foundation of their relationship.

Memorable Moments with Hassan Youssef ✨
Shams recounted a trip to Damascus, her father’s birthplace, where Hassan Youssef wanted her to see the place where their love story began.
"He pointed to the hotel where our love story started, the family celebrated with us, and my aunt Ilham presented me with a certified family lineage document from Damascus" 💖
This illustrates his genuine love and care, ensuring she shared these historic moments with family, deepening their emotional bond.
Retirement Decision and Spiritual Journey 🕊️
Shams revealed her retirement decision after returning from performing Umrah with her father, despite Hassan Youssef preparing a new film for her production and direction.
She wrote:
"I returned to my love; I don’t want all this worldly life, I don’t want this worldly pleasure, I don’t want acting, decision made" ✨
Her husband respected her choice without opposition, showing unconditional support and trust.
